{"id":869,"date":"2014-07-23T21:10:38","date_gmt":"2014-07-23T21:10:38","guid":{"rendered":"https:\/\/fir3netwp.gmsrrpobkbd.com\/?p=869"},"modified":"2021-07-24T17:09:37","modified_gmt":"2021-07-24T17:09:37","slug":"why-are-my-gtm-monitor-connections-no-estblishing","status":"publish","type":"post","link":"https:\/\/www.fir3net.com\/Loadbalancers\/F5-BIG-IP\/why-are-my-gtm-monitor-connections-no-estblishing.html","title":{"rendered":"Why are the GTM monitor connections not establishing ?"},"content":{"rendered":"
You may observe the GTM being unable to successfully establish a TCP connection when initaing a monitor probe to a given destination. Spefically, the GTM will send the SYN, but you notice the destination not responding with the SYN-ACK.<\/p>\n
There are 2 reasons that can cause this behaviour,<\/p>\n
This occurs when the TIME_WAIT timeout value is different on both the GTM and the server, resulting in the server failing to respond to new connection attempts.<\/p>\n
This means the server does not respond to any connection (that attempts from the GTM This means that the GTM reaps the connection first and then tries to estblish a new connection withonce the TCP connection goes into a TIME_WAIT state on the webserver the GTM will then remove this connection once the TIME_WAIT value has been reached. As the webserver still has the connection in a TIME_WAIT state, when the GTM issues a new connection request of using the same source port, the web server will fail to respond to the SYN.<\/p>\n
Reference : http:\/\/blog.davidvassallo.me\/2010\/07\/13\/time_wait-and-port-reuse\/<\/a><\/p>\n In instances where you have multiple monitor destinations (i.e websites) behind a single (Non LTM\/iQuery based) loadbalancer, due to the GTM is sending out connection requests to different IP addresses, and using the same source port. The backend server behind the loadbalancer will see additional connection requests from the GTM with the same source port and same source IP. If a connection is already estlishbed and the server sees an additional connection request it will be ingnored as the connection request will be from a source IP and source port for a connection that is already estlished within the TCP table.<\/p>\n To resolve this you can disable socket reused via the following command,<\/p>\n Reference : http:\/\/support.f5.com\/kb\/en-us\/solutions\/public\/13000\/800\/sol13820<\/a><\/p>\n","protected":false},"excerpt":{"rendered":" Issue You may observe the GTM being unable to successfully establish a TCP connection when initaing a monitor probe to a given destination. Spefically, the GTM will send the SYN, but you notice the destination not responding with the SYN-ACK. There are 2 reasons that can cause this behaviour, Time-Wait Mismatch This occurs when the … Read more<\/a><\/p>\n","protected":false},"author":2,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[15],"tags":[],"yoast_head":"\nSource Port Reuse<\/h2>\n
modify\u00a0sys db bigd.reusesocket value disable save \/sys config<\/pre>\n